Senior station officer Ryan McCarty from Napier said the truck was held above the ravine by two large trees that snapped in the crash.
"So he was sort of hanging - the truck was wedged against one bank and the back side was overhanging the ravine. The ravine was a quite a steep drop underneath, probably a good 30m ... as far as extrications go it was probably about as hard as they come."
A rescue helicopter attended but the person was taken to hospital by road ambulance. Their condition is critical.
